What does a strategic purchasing manager do?

A Strategic Purchasing Manager is responsible for overseeing the procurement process and developing strategies to ensure the organization sources goods and services efficiently and cost-effectively. They analyze market trends, negotiate with suppliers, and build strong relationships to secure the best terms. Their role often includes managing budgets, evaluating supplier performance, and working closely with other departments to align purchasing strategies with overall business goals. Ultimately, Strategic Purchasing Managers help organizations optimize their supply chains and maintain a competitive edge.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a strategic purchasing manager?

To thrive as a Strategic Purchasing Manager, you need expertise in procurement strategies, contract negotiation, supplier management, and often a degree in supply chain management or business. Familiarity with ERP systems, sourcing platforms, and relevant certifications such as CPSM (Certified Professional in Supply Management) are highly valued. Strong analytical thinking, communication, and leadership skills set top performers apart in this role. These skills are crucial for optimizing costs, ensuring supply chain resilience, and driving value for the organization.

How does a strategic purchasing manager typically collaborate with other departments within an organization?

A Strategic Purchasing Manager regularly works cross-functionally with various departments such as production, finance, and logistics to ensure sourcing strategies align with organizational goals. They coordinate with engineering and product teams to understand specific material requirements, partner with finance to manage budgets and cost-saving initiatives, and communicate with logistics to optimize supply chain efficiency. Effective collaboration is essential for negotiating contracts, maintaining supplier relationships, and resolving supply issues promptly. This role often serves as a bridge between internal stakeholders and external suppliers to drive value and mitigate risks.

AMER Purchasing Manager - Americas, Advanced Materials

Huntsman is seeking an AMER Purchasing Manager - Americas, Advanced Materials supporting the Advanced Materials Division located in The Woodlands, Texas. This position will report to the Global Director Purchasing - Advanced Materials.

Job Scope

The AMER Purchasing Manager is responsible for leading the Advanced Materials Raw Materials procurement organization across the Americas. This role translates global procurement strategies into effective regional execution while ensuring regional market conditions, operational requirements, and business priorities are represented in global sourcing decisions. The position provides leadership to a team of procurement professionals and partners closely with Business, Operations, Supply Chain, Finance, R&D, and senior leaders to drive sourcing strategies, supplier performance, cost competitiveness, and supply continuity.

In summary, as the AMER Purchasing Manager, you will:
  • Lead and develop a team of three procurement professionals across the Americas region.
  • Execute global sourcing strategies and align them with regional business and manufacturing requirements.
  • Drive sourcing initiatives focused on cost reduction, supply resilience, working capital improvement, and business performance.
  • Lead complex supplier negotiations and develop long-term supply agreements.
  • Analyze market intelligence, supplier performance, spend data, and supply risks to support business decisions.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ify opportunities in alternative sourcing, supplier consolidation, specification changes, portfolio optimization, and inventory management.
  • Manage supplier relationships and performance across cost, quality, delivery, innovation, and risk metrics.
  • Support manufacturing sites in resolving critical supply, quality, and contractual issues.
  • Develop business cases and provide recommendations to senior leadership.
  • Ensure compliance with Huntsman policies, purchasing procedures, contracts, and applicable regulations.
  • Participate in global procurement initiatives, transformation programs, and cross-regional projects.
  • Foster a culture of accountability, collaboration, transparency, and continuous improvement.
